Your Roadmap to the Non-fiction Book Writing Process
Do you know about book graveyards where editors at publishing houses bury the books that don’t ever see the light of publication? As an aspiring non-fiction author, you need to be forewarned about these types of pitfalls. This workshop will serve as the roadmap-in-hand that you’ll need to tread the traditional book-publishing road wisely. You’ll walk out knowing what to expect from the glimmer of an idea all the way through to your book’s publication date. This workshop will grant you the courage to control the things you can and the wisdom to let go of the things you can’t, so you can focus on writing the best book possible. Learn about the role of agents and editors, the non-fiction book publishing process, how to make the best choices for your book, and how to form win-win-win relationships with the publishing industry players on your book’s team.
